If two bodies are projected at 30⁰ and 60⁰ respectively with the same velocity, then

Options

(a) Their ranges are same
(b) Their heights are same
(c) Their times of flight are same
(d) All of these are same

Correct Answer:

Their ranges are same

Explanation:

Substituting θ in R=u²sin2θ/g
For 30° sin2θ => 60°
For 60° sin2θ => 120°
sin 120° = sin(180° − 120°) = √3/2
So Range is equal.
